Chemically engineered nano titanium oxide (TiO2) loaded polyaniline matrix of architecture ITO/ titanium oxide-polyaniline/Aluminum is used for photovoltaic application. The performance of fabricated photovoltaic cell shows good dependence on concentration of TiO2. The power conversion efficiency increases with an increasing concentration of TiO2. The increase in power conversation efficiency originated from high absorption on visible region. The fabricated photovoltaic cells generated stable photocurrent and photovoltage under light illumination.
